Heat Pump Replacement in Ontario, CA

Replacing a full heat pump system is one of the most effective ways to cut energy bills, improve year‑round comfort, and reduce emissions in Ontario, CA homes. With hot summers, occasional poor air quality, and growing incentive programs for electrification across Southern California, a modern, properly sized heat pump can deliver reliable cooling and efficient heating while lowering operating costs and improving indoor comfort.

Why replace your heat pump in Ontario, CA

  • Older systems lose efficiency over time and often struggle during Inland Empire peak summer temperatures.
  • Many homes still operate on aging refrigerants (R‑22) or single‑stage systems that short‑cycle and fail to control humidity.
  • Local incentives and evolving California efficiency standards make replacement a timely opportunity to move to high‑efficiency, low‑GWP equipment.
  • Correct replacement addresses common issues like uneven temperatures, high utility bills, noisy operation, and frequent repairs.

Common heat pump problems driving replacement

  • Frequent breakdowns and high repair frequency on equipment older than 10–15 years
  • Low cooling capacity during summer peak loads or inadequate heating on cool nights
  • Leaking refrigerant, especially in systems using phased‑out refrigerants
  • Poor humidity control and short cycling from oversized or undersized units
  • Duct leaks and poor airflow in ducted systems that reduce overall system effectiveness

On-site assessment and load calculations

A thorough in‑home assessment is the first step:

  • Manual J load calculation to determine precise heating and cooling requirements based on house size, insulation, orientation, window types, and local climate loads specific to Ontario, CA.
  • Manual D duct evaluation when ducts exist to identify leaks, insulation levels, and required modifications for balanced airflow.
  • Inspection of current electrical service, breaker capacity, and any needed panel upgrades for new heat pump electrical loads.Accurate sizing prevents common problems: oversized units short‑cycle and fail to dehumidify; undersized units run continuously and still miss comfort targets.

Choosing the right technology and capacity

Typical options and when they make sense:

  • Air‑source heat pump (ducted): Best for homes with existing ductwork. Modern inverter-driven units offer improved efficiency, quieter operation, and better humidity control than older single‑speed models.
  • Ductless mini‑split heat pump: Ideal for homes without ducts, additions, or rooms needing zoned control. Installing one or more heads avoids costly ductwork and gives precise zone temperature control.
  • Multi‑zone and multi‑stage systems: Provide better comfort and efficiency in larger homes or where load varies by area.
  • Ground‑source (geothermal) systems: Highest efficiency but higher upfront complexity and cost; most appropriate where long‑term energy savings justify the investment.

Energy‑efficiency features to prioritize:

  • Variable‑speed/inverter compressors for consistent temperatures and superior dehumidification
  • High SEER and HSPF ratings (look for models that exceed minimum California standards)
  • Low‑GWP refrigerants and equipment designed for future code compliance

Removal, refrigerant handling, and disposal

Proper removal protects you and the environment:

  • Refrigerant recovery per EPA regulations (certified technicians perform refrigerant recovery and documentation)
  • Responsible disposal and recycling of metal components, insulation, and old electronics to meet local waste rules in Ontario
  • Safe handling of any hazardous materials and verification that refrigerant type is recorded for future compliance

Installation timeline and process

Typical timelines depending on job scope:

  • Straight swap (same location, similar equipment): 1–3 days. This includes removal, mounting new outdoor and indoor units, refrigerant charging, and start‑up testing.
  • Ductwork repairs, zoning, or electrical panel upgrades: 3–7 days depending on extent of work.
  • Multi‑head mini‑split installations or full system redesigns may take longer to coordinate and complete.Installations include equipment placement, refrigerant piping, electrical connections, line insulation, and finish work to restore any disturbed surfaces.

Permitting and code compliance

Replacement work must comply with California building codes and local permitting:

  • Building and mechanical permits through the City of Ontario (permit required for major replacements and equipment changes)
  • Compliance with California Title 24 energy requirements and up‑to‑date appliance efficiency standards
  • Work performed by licensed HVAC contractors (California C‑20 licensing for HVAC) and certified refrigerant handlers to meet safety and inspection standards

Warranties and expected performance improvements

  • Typical warranty profiles: parts warranties commonly 5–10 years; compressors often carry 10‑year limited warranties; labor warranties vary but are commonly 1 year with optional extensions.
  • Expected performance gains: modern heat pumps can reduce heating and cooling energy use substantially compared with older systems—often 20–50% depending on previous equipment condition, duct losses, and local usage patterns.
  • Improved comfort: better humidity control, quieter operation, and more even temperatures throughout the home.

Post‑installation testing and homeowner orientation

Commissioning and verification ensure the system performs as designed:

  • Refrigerant charge verification, airflow and static pressure measurements, and electrical safety checks
  • Thermostat calibration and verification of staging or inverter controls
  • Leak check of refrigerant joints and verification of proper defrost cycle operation
  • System documentation including equipment specs, refrigerant type and charge, and maintenance recommendations
  • Demonstration for homeowners on system operation, mode settings, and routine filters/maintenance

Maintenance and long‑term considerations

  • Regular filter changes, annual or biannual tune‑ups, and periodic duct inspections maintain efficiency and extend system life.
  • In Ontario’s hot summers, attention to condenser coil cleanliness and adequate outdoor airflow preserves cooling capacity.
  • Monitoring for refrigerant leaks, unusual sounds, or reduced capacity helps catch small issues before they require major repairs.
